Books mentioned:
Clergy Killers, G. Lloyd Rediger
Forgiving What You Can't Forget, Lisa Terkeurst
Emotionally Healthy Spirituality, Peter Scazzero
In this conversation, Ron Cook shares his personal experiences with betrayal in ministry, detailing a significant incident that led to a crisis in his leadership. He discusses the emotional and spiritual challenges he faced, the support he received from unexpected sources, and the lessons learned through the pain. Ron emphasizes the importance of trusting God's plan and the growth that can come from difficult experiences. In this conversation, Ron Cook discusses the themes of healing through brokenness, the challenges of dealing with clergy killers in churches, and the importance of stewardship of pain. He emphasizes the need for trust and healing after betrayal, and shares insights on how to support pastoral families through difficult times. The conversation also highlights the resources available for pastors and their families to navigate their emotional health and spiritual growth.
